Rory Kerins Set For NHL Debut On Monday

Calgary Flames forward Rory Kerins will make his NHL debut in Monday's matchup against Chicago. The 22-year-old will get his first taste of action in the big league following an impressive campaign in the minors. Ilya Sorokin Returns To Practice Monday

New York Islanders goaltender Ilya Sorokin (illness) practiced on Monday. He was back on the ice after missing Saturday's game against Utah due to illness. Michael Bunting Misses Sunday's Action

Pittsburgh Penguins left wing Michael Bunting (undisclosed) will not play in Sunday's contest against Tampa Bay. Penguins head coach Mike Sullivan told reporters ahead of the game that Bunting was involved in a car accident outside of PPG Paints Arena.
